VISA® Check Card


The Fast and Convenient Way to Access Your ACU Checking Account!


The VISA Check Card is an ATM/Debit card. It enables you to make purchases and withdraw cash from your ACU Checking account. It can be used anywhere VISA®  is accepted worldwide, 24-hours a day, 7 days a week.

VISA Check Card Benefits

No Annual Fee  
Unlimited Free ATM transactions at ACU machines Use ACU owned ATMs to avoid service fees and access funds in your checking or savings account.
Up to 5 ATM transactions per month at non-ACU ATMs with no ACU fees* Access your funds at ATMs worldwide. Look for the Cirrus & Star logos.
Surcharge Free ATM Networks Aceess your money surcharge-free at over 57,000 ATMs by using Allpoint, STARsf or Co-op ATM Networks. Use our ATM Locator  to find surcharge-free ATM's near you.
Unlimited Point Of Sale (POS) Transactions Purchase goods/services up to the available balance in your checking account (less ATM withdrawals) anywhere VISA is accepted.
Withdrawal Limit Up to $600 of your available balance each day
* If other ATMs charge transaction or access fees, these will be passed along and reflected on your statement.

Important Reminders ...

  • Always protect your ACU Visa Check Card & Personal Identification Number (PIN) as you would cash, checks, and credit cards.
  • DO NOT keep your PIN with your ACU VISA Check Card and always keep it confidential!
  • Keep your receipts when making purchases & ATM transactions with your card and record them in your check register when you return home.
  • You may make point-of-sale purchases up to the available balance in your checking account (less any ATM withdrawals). Transactions in excess of the available balance will be declined.
  • Remember your ACU VISA Check Card is Not a Credit Card. VISA Check Card transactions are automatically withdrawn from your checking account.
  • When making point-of-sale purchases tell the merchant you plan to pay with VISA.
  • When traveling out of the country notify ACU beforehand. In an effort to prevent fraud, VISA monitors card activity and spending habits of every cardholder. If your card is used out of the country or out of your normal shopping pattern, Visa will attempt to contact you to verify that you are actually performing the transactions. If they are unable to reach you, they may temporarily put a hold on your account in an effort to stop fraudulent activity. By notifying ACU, Visa will have a record of your travels and will know that you are personally using your card in a foreign country.
